Abstract
A hemostatic agent delivery system includes a hemostatic agent which is inert and non-reactive yet is capable of forming a stable clot when applied to an actively bleeding wound. The system also includes a delivery assembly to structure to facilitate delivery of the hemostatic agent proximate the hemorrhage site. More specifically, the delivery assembly is structured to releasably contain the hemostatic agent via a release member which is disposed in cooperative relation with a support member which contains the amount of the hemostatic agent. The release member is structured of a soluble material such that it will at least partially dissolve and release the hemostatic agent upon disposition proximate the hemorrhage site. The delivery assembly further comprises a handle member structured to facilitate delivery of the hemostatic agent to the hemorrhage site.
